
Second Time No Charm For ‘Playboy Club’ ‘Charlie’s Angels’ & ‘Prime Suspect’: What Went Wrong?
ABC has put the flailing Charlie’s Angels remake out of its misery. The small ratings uptick last night didn’t save the freshman, which has now been canceled, with production on it shut down. I hear ABC intends to run the episodes that have been already made. Sony TV has shot a total of 8 episodes, including the pilot. Four of them have aired. After a low-rated debut, the Charlie’s Angels reboot dropped precipitously for 2 weeks to a 1.2 ratings in adults 18-49 last Thursday before posting a tiny increase to a 1.3 last night. But that turned out to be too little too late…
Here is a summary on where ABC’s fall series with 13-episode orders stand. Freshmen Suburgatory and Revenge have received Back 9 orders, while Charlie’s Angels has been canceled. Sophomores Happy Endings and Body Of Proof have been given script orders: 6 scripts for Happy Endings and 2 for Body Of Proof.
